Situated on a slight S-facing slope. Archaeological testing (04E0915) by S. Delaney (2005) at Testing Area 12 of Contract 4 of the M3 motorway identified (excavations.ie 2004:1355) archaeological material that was completely excavated (E003151) in November 2006 by Y. Whitty (2010) as Town Parks 5 when an area of 4782 square metres was opened to record a Neolithic house and structure (excavations.ie 2007:1399).
A rectangular structure (ext. dims 6.5m WNW-ESE; 4m NNE-SSW) defined by pairs of postholes at the angles was c. 50m SE of the Neolithic house. Samples from the postholes identified oak almost exclusively. A slot-trench, with a central posthole forms the E wall, and a short gully at the SW posts may be the last remnant of a similar W wall but there is no evidence of N and S walls. The paired posts are on a WNW-ESE alignment, suggesting that the stresses of the structure were in these directions. Most of the posts had decayed in situ, and the postholes produced two sherds of pottery and occasional fragments of calcined animal bone. A sample of hazelnut shell from one of the postholes provided the C14 date 3770-3654 cal. BC (UBA 12048), and oak from another yielded a date of 3698-3637 cal. BC (UBA 12046). Four pits (dims 0.58m x 0.25m; D 0.15m to 3.28m x 0.88m; D 0.26m) and a posthole are within 3-4m of the structure, but only produced one sherd of pottery. (Whitty 11-15)
See the attached site plan and monument plan from Whitty (2010, figs 6, 9)
